Correct storage and charging of e-bikes, scooters, and similar devices is really important:

They’ll only be allowed in our properties where they can be safely stored and charged without affecting the safe escape from the property in the case of fire.

If you want to own or store a mobility scooter, e-bike/scooter, or similar device you’ll need to obtain our permission first. You can get in touch using the contact details at the bottom of this page.

Safely storing your e-bike, scooter, or other battery-powered device:

Before you purchase one of these devices, you must let us know so that we can check that there’s enough space to store it safely and ensure that you have the required insurance in place in line with our Mobility scooter, e-bike, and similar devices policy.

It shouldn’t block your fire escape route or cause obstruction to any visitors. If you store your device inside your home, it mustn’t pose a risk to yourself or others, for example, by blocking escape routes.

Safely charging and maintaining your e-bike, scooter, or other battery-powered device:

Charging should only be carried out during daytime hours and not overnight. These devices shouldn’t be left unattended while charging.

You must ensure that your device is serviced and maintained regularly and be able to show us evidence of this if requested.
